The Top Skill a Copywriter Needs to Have

If I had to boil down the number one skill a copywriter must have, it’s this: deep listening with empathy. Not just hearing words, but truly listening—to what’s said, what’s unsaid, and what’s beneath the surface.

When I work with a client, I don’t come in cold. Before we even have our first conversation, I’ve done my homework. I’ve read your website, listened to your podcast, scrolled through your social media, and paid attention to what’s already resonating with your audience. This allows me to meet you where you are and start uncovering the deeper layers of your message.

The ability to distill complex, sometimes scattered thoughts into a clear, compelling narrative is a huge part of what I do. My job is to reflect back to you the essence of your brand in a way that feels aligned and true—while also being optimized for sales and conversions.

How I Identify Client Blind Spots to Deliver a Better Experience

A huge part of my job is to identify the blind spots in my clients’ messaging. Often, these blind spots exist because the things that make you unique feel so normal to you.

You might assume that everyone does what you do, or that your approach isn’t particularly groundbreaking. It can be hard to see your expertise for what it is (transformational!) when it is your normal. 

I help you articulate your expertise without dumbing it down by paying attention to:

  • The recurring themes that keep coming up in our conversations

  • The things you almost say but then hesitate on

  • The stories you tell repeatedly, even in passing

  • The messaging that feels slightly out of alignment but you haven’t quite figured out why

When I notice these patterns, I bring them to your attention. Often, this is where the magic happens—where you have that lightbulb moment of, Oh wow, I didn’t even realize that was important.

And that’s when we start crafting messaging that truly reflects who you are now—not just who you were when you first started your business.

What I Am Listening for in the Copywriting Process

So how do I pick up on those golden insights that transform your messaging? I’m constantly listening for:

  • Recurring themes – What are the things you keep circling back to?

  • Avoidance patterns – Where do you start to go deep but then back away?

  • The ‘almost’ moments – What are the things you’re almost saying but aren’t quite ready to?

  • Emotional triggers – When do you get particularly excited, passionate, or hesitant?

My job is to notice these patterns and gently bring them into the light. It’s in these moments of clarity that your most powerful, compelling messaging emerges.
